Critical Evaluation
Value of the Information & Strength of the Argument
The video provides valuable insights by bridging two complex fields: cosmology and nuclear engineering. Folse’s analogies are effective in making abstract cosmological concepts more tangible, such as comparing the Hubble tension to different methods of measuring reactor power. His argumentation is solid, as he consistently ties back to his professional experience, offering concrete examples from nuclear reactor operations. However, the video is primarily a reaction and commentary, so the depth of argumentation is limited by the original content. Folse does not present new evidence but rather interprets existing findings through his expert lens, which adds value for viewers seeking a different perspective.

Contribution & Novelties
The video’s original contribution lies in its unique perspective: a nuclear engineer applying his professional knowledge to interpret cosmological anomalies. This cross-disciplinary approach offers fresh analogies that may help viewers understand complex concepts. For example, comparing the Hubble tension to different reactor power measurement methods provides a concrete mental model. The video also emphasizes the importance of scientific crisis as a driver of progress, a viewpoint that resonates with the history of nuclear science.
